The much-awaited official trailer of Madhuram Jeevamruthabindu has been released by Saina Play, promising an emotionally charged cinematic experience that explores the complexities of life, love, and relationships through multiple stories. Directed by Shamzu Zayba, Appu N Bhattathiri, Prince Joy, and Jenith Kachappilly, this Malayalam anthology features an exceptional star cast including Lal, Basil Joseph, Saiju Kurupp, Suhasini Manirathnam, Vinay Fort, Jaffer Idukki, Mala Parvathi, Punya Elizabeth, Dayyana Hameed, and Waffa Katheeja.

Produced by Arjun Ravindran and A.V. Anoop in association with Aashiq Bava and Christy Parappukaran, Madhuram Jeevamruthabindu showcases the creative collaboration of some of Malayalam cinema’s most talented filmmakers and technicians. The script is penned by Jenith Kachappilly, S Sanjeev, and Jishnu S Ramesh, weaving together emotionally rich narratives that promise to touch hearts.
The film’s trailer, edited by Navaneeth S Chandran, sets the tone for a soulful journey. The visuals, captured by cinematographers Sajad Kaakku, Gikku Jacob Peter, Syamaprakash M.S., and Nithin R.D., beautifully convey the essence of everyday life, while the music and background score, composed by Arun Muraleedharan, Sreehari K Nair, and Sidhartha Pradeep, add a melodious layer of emotion.
Behind the scenes, the production is supported by a stellar technical crew including editors Appu N Bhattathiri, Akash Joseph Varghese, Nimz, and Malavika V.N., production designer Arshad Nakkoth, and costume designers Siji Thomas Nobbel, Dhanya Balakrishnan, Femina Jabbar, and Merlin Lisabeth.
The lyrical beauty of the songs comes from writers Manu Manjith, Vaisakh Sugunan, Shihas Ammedkoya, Muzammil Kunnummal, Rani Devi, Mridul, and Jenith Kachappilly, reflecting the depth of human emotions that the film seeks to portray.
With sound design by PC Vishnu, Fazal A Backer, Vishnu Sujathan, Abhishek S Bhattathiri, and Shankaran A.S. Shefin Mayan, and visual effects handled by Mindstein, Egg White VFX, Wefx Media, and Promice, the film maintains high production values throughout.
Madhuram Jeevamruthabindu looks like a heartfelt Malayalam film that celebrates humanity and the bittersweet flavors of life. The trailer hints at multiple touching stories bound by emotions, relationships, and music — making it one of the most awaited releases from Saina Play.
